Transaction 3cddbe822c8712661607528043827184b18f021f0407a46ae261204b900f3beb

1 Input
2 Outputs
  • 3cddbe822c8712661607528043827184b18f021f0407a46ae261204b900f3beb:0
  • value  937946
    address  35bMFR4zagG3t1XiZusAa6m5m1sS1gP6s7
  • 3cddbe822c8712661607528043827184b18f021f0407a46ae261204b900f3beb:1
  • value  649351791
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o